Output 51d0f8c76edfdf2443f2f2c031e9d59ca31a90905a0705bc87950701a97589ee:1

value
73436920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a28ac1e4f54f645f7b44ce57a5373bc0ff8ba40 OP_EQUAL
address
3EHXtyneX9KhmcauqWXMS4TGyTh1syQHos
transaction
51d0f8c76edfdf2443f2f2c031e9d59ca31a90905a0705bc87950701a97589ee
spent
true